Hi can anyone help me I have been asked to do a Christmas fair tomorrow (short notice) and I need to print off business cards but don't have a clue where to start.

I have the paper from Stationary Box but I cannot find a template on Microsoft Works.

Does anyonr know where I can download a program preferably free tonight.

many thanks in advance
 
I did my own with Prestick Matte a4 Inkjet Business Cards. On the back it gave you instructions on how to do with Microsoft Word. It told you to go to tools menu, Select Envelopes and Labels. Go to Labels Menu and Select Options. In Label Products click on Avery A4 and A5 and product number L7414 business card. Double click on that the click new document. From there you are on your way to making your own it was very easy. Does you business card sheets give you any setup instructions on package. It was very simple.
